Grosse Pointe Shores is a small, affluent community located along Lake St. Clair in Michigan's Wayne and Macomb counties. Originally developed as a summer retreat for Detroit's wealthy families in the early 20th century, the village maintains its historic character through well-preserved mansions and architectural landmarks.
One of its most notable cultural attractions is the Edsel and Eleanor Ford House, an impressive estate designed by architect Albert Kahn in the 1920s. This lakeside property, reflecting the architectural and cultural heritage of the area, serves as both a historic house museum and a testament to the region's automotive history. The village's location along Lake St. Clair has influenced its development and continues to be an important aspect of its community identity.
